A group 15 element forms \( d\pi - d\pi \) bond with transition metals. It also forms a hydride, which is the strongest base among the hydrides of other group members that form \( d\pi - d\pi \) bonds. The atomic number of the element is …….

Solution and Explanation

The element must belong to Group 15 and participate in \( d\pi - d\pi \) bonding. Potential candidates include N, P, and As. Phosphorus (\( P \)) exhibits \( d\pi - d\pi \) bonding. Furthermore, \( PH_3 \) functions as a stronger base than \( AsH_3 \). The atomic number of Phosphorus is 15.
